Editorial summary

Formaldehyde and TVOC emissions were followed across manufacturing stages for laminate and engineered wood flooring, including application of decorative layers and final surface finishes. FLEC measurements show that finishing can substantially reduce emissions, although intermediate bonding steps may temporarily increase them.
